What are the best road trip destinations near Latsida?
You don’t need to spend all your time in Latsida when there’s a great big world out there to see! Just 25 miles away, Heraklion will keep you on the go with top-notch attractions like Heraklion Archaeological Museum. Palace of Knossos is another popular attraction.
Where are the best beaches near Latsida?
Nothing screams vacation like hopping in the car, blasting some tunes and driving to the coast. Latsida has some gorgeous beaches nearby, so bring along a good book (and a kite if the wind’s up) and make your way to one of these beautiful options:

  • Stalis Beach (9 miles away).
  • Sarandaris Beach (12 miles away).
  • Voulisma Beach (14 miles away).

What side of the road do they drive on in Latsida?
In Latsida, you’ll need to stick to the right side. When exploring someplace new, it’s wise to choose an automatic vehicle. That way, you can focus on the road and not stress about gear changes.

Are there speed limits in Latsida?
There sure are. In Latsida, speed limits range from 50km/h to 130km/h. Most built-up areas have a maximum speed limit of 50km/h unless posted otherwise.
What happens if I get a speeding fine while driving a rental car in Agios Nikolaos?
More often than not, your chosen rental car company will bill the amount stated on the fine to your credit card, including local taxes. Or they may provide your contact details to local law enforcement agencies, who’ll then issue a fine to your postal address.
Is it illegal to use a cell phone while driving in Latsida?
As with many places, regular cell phone usage is not permitted while driving around Latsida. However, there is an exception for hands-free or Bluetooth capabilities. Just remember to maintain focus on the road.
What are the rules around drink driving in Latsida?
The legal BAC (blood alcohol content) limit when operating a vehicle in Latsida is 0.05%. If you’re planning on partying, leave your car behind and organize a different way of getting home instead.
Is turning on a red light allowed in Latsida?
No. In Latsida, red equals stop, with no exceptions. When nearing traffic lights, always maintain a safe speed so you can easily stop if you need to.
Are seat belts compulsory in Agios Nikolaos?
Seat belts must be worn in Agios Nikolaos. Having said that, these rules may not apply for some vehicles, like those operated by public transportation systems.
